Removing the center console is one of the easier DIY tasks involving our JL's.

There are 4 bolts under 4 plastic covers. The following pictures highlight the process, including how to remove the 4WD Shift Handle. The round covers are in the front, the square ones are in the back (accessible after pulling both seats forward).

The frame around the 4WD handle simply pops off, as it's secured by body clips.

Tools: 10mm Socket for the 4 Bolts and a T-25 Torx for the gear shift handle.

PS: There's no reason to remove the 4 small Torx screws on the ball of the handle.

Am I able to swap out the console on my
Jl sport for a Sahara jl console which has the 2 usb plugs and a 110 outlet
The 110v outlet cannot be added by simply adding in the plug, There is an inverter and most likely additional wiring needed to make this work. If you want the USB's to work those can most likely be made operational by replacing the console harness with part # 68350769AE

-Benny

Not sure how you are planning the route for your phone. I used the access cover to bring a 3.5mm plug from under the passenger seat up to the AUX In so my GMRS radio could use the vehicle radio and speakers. The access panel has a light rubber strap that can be removed, I took the access cover to the work bench and drilled a hole so that cable could pass through. Then reassembled the strap and popped the access cover back in place.
